## KeyTumbler 3.0 — changed defaults

Rotation interval drops from 90 days to 30. Grace window for old credentials shrinks to 24 hours. Dry-run mode is now off by default; pass the explicit flag if you want it. Failed rotations page the owning team instead of silently retrying. If you joined after the Velmarsh migration, none of the legacy paths apply to you. Read the ops wiki before touching prod. The shipped defaults are listed below.

config for kajog-tadug:
[casax]
port = 11211
region = west-3
host = casax.nelvroworks.internal
timeout_ms = 5000
retries = 7

Ticket: Staging env misconfigured for Siftgate bloom filter

The bloom layer in front of the Pellet KV store is rejecting all lookups in staging because the env file was copied from the dev template without credentials. False-positive tuning values are fine; only the auth line is missing. To unblock the weekly demo, the Pellet admission secret must be set on the following line.

env line for yaguf-fajop: LEDGER_TOKEN13=fb08984397349

# Handover: TideTeller widget

Taking over TideTeller? Key points: the widget pulls tide predictions from the Marrowgate forecast service nightly and caches them in `tide_cache`. The interpolation code in `curve.py` is fragile — don't refactor without the golden test set. Daylight-saving transitions are handled in the renderer, not the fetcher; that's intentional. Pending: the Brellport station returns stale data sporadically, unresolved. Any architectural decisions or cache schema changes must be approved by the maintainer named below.

account owner for kafop-haweg: Pelax Gilael Istir